Records custodian job description
Example records custodian requirements on a job description
- Bachelor's degree in Records Management or related field.
- Minimum of 2 years of experience in records management.
- Familiarity with records management principles and best practices.
- Proficient in the use of records management software.
- Excellent organizational and communication skills.
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
- Ability to handle multiple tasks simultaneously.
- Ability to effectively prioritize tasks.
- Strong problem-solving and decision-making capabilities.

POSITION SUMMARY
This position is responsible for providing mail room and file room services in support of various business functions. The individual will gather, prepare and process daily releases of paid in full contracts and vehicle titles, daily general outbound correspondence, and filing of new customer contract packages. This position is also cross-trained in imaging services.
This position reports to the Vice President of Quality Assurance. This position will work in close conjunction with the Records Custodian II. This position provides services to other departments, including Customer Service, Title Administration, and Funding.
The successful candidate is self-directed in work prioritization, highly organized and detail-oriented, and demonstrates superior judgment-making ability within the scope of the position’s areas of responsibility. The associate will perform all duties in accordance with CIG Financial policies and procedures and all state and federal regulations.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ES
- Responsible for the day-to-day operations of the Records File Room.
- Works closely with other team members to ensure all aspects of records tasks are completed .
- Perform various Mail Center activities (sorting, metering, folding, inserting, delivery, pickup, etc.).
- Maintains mail/records room in a neat, tidy manner.
- Stocks copiers/printers with paper and envelopes.
- Maintain files and imaged records so they remain updated and easily accessible.
- Sort, organize and scan a high volume of documents for all company departments.
- Using PC image scanners, scans various types of records and documents.
- Perform various file-pulling projects and purging projects throughout the year.
- Sends out and requests time sensitive (electronic and paper) documents.
- Assists Records Custodian II in the custodial review process.
- Communicate to departments when files are incomplete or otherwise need attention.
- Perform special projects or other related work as required or requested.
